Portuguese proverb of the day: 'One day belongs to the prey, another to the hunter'

Image
The age-old Portuguese saying, "One day belongs to the prey, another to the hunter," encapsulates the unpredictable nature of life. This proverb serves as a poignant reminder that success and failure are fleeting. Shootout in Mexico: 11 armed attackers killed in police confrontation

A violent confrontation in Nuevo Leon, Mexico resulted in the deaths of 11 armed attackers who targeted a police station in General Teran. State police, the national guard, and the army launched an operation that led to capturing one suspect and seizing six pick-up trucks while pursuing the attackers along a highway near Monterrey.
